Your body needs to burn more calories than it takes into it - PERIOD! You can achieve this by two ways. Cutting calories, Exercise or a combination of both. Take in fewer calories and burn more - That’s it. Now, how many calories should you consume? I have a little calculator over on the left hand side towards the bottom. You can select the settings to what you are now just to see what they are but the important thing is to choose the setting of what weight you want to be.
I thought as a challenge that I would sign up for the Presidential Fitness Challenge. It’s free and you can win awards for getting fit. I currently have my settings on the Active LifeStyle Award. I just need to exercise atleast 5 days per week for 6 weeks. I can then move up to other awards such as the Presidential Champions Bronze, Silver and Gold Challenges.
